God’s Words
Psalms 119:105 NIV
“Your word is a lamp for my feet, a light on my path.”
God’s words will guide us, if we investigate His words and read with understanding. Bible reading is not all about getting through the Bible in a Year. Yes, that is a great goal, especially if we listen to an app or on biblegateway.com and follow along with the written word. What benefit is that? We will hear things that we have never heard before, so we mark those things down and study them later. Underlining in the Bible or making notes in a notebook is a great idea for retaining what we have heard and read. Why would we do this? Because God’s words are an illumination to our insight and His words will direct our path. When we are doing our own thing, it’s hard to follow God, but when we seek wisdom in His words, He makes every path illuminated so that we can see clearly and avoid the pitfalls. Sometimes we wonder how we missed the mark or got off God’s path. Well, finding out where we go from here is found in His words. God knows where we are in our journey and His words can lead, and guide us into His presence.
